LANCER RODEO TEAM IN FIRST PLACE
18 April 2013The Eastern Wyoming College men's rodeo team is in first place in the standings for the Central Rocky Mountain Region with two rodeos to go in the spring season. The Lancers have 3,433.33 points to second place University of Wyoming's 3,230 and third place Gillette's 3,125. The Lancers also have the lead in men's all-around and team roping. The points are accumulated through the five fall and three spring rodeos each year with the top two teams and the top individuals qualifying for the College National Finals Rodeo to be held in Casper in mid-June.
The remaining schedule is the Casper College Rodeo April 19-21 and the University of Wyoming Rodeo May 3-5. The points earned at those two events will be added to the current standings. The rodeo results and standings may be found at nira.com.

Winchell finishes third at CNFR
18 June 2012EASTERN WYOMING COLLEGE RODEO TEAM MEMBER, SHELBY WINCHELL finished third in the nation in goat tying at the College National Finals Rodeo held in Casper. Winchell from Scottsbluff, NE, qualified for the CNFR by finishing second in the Central Rocky Mountain Region for the 2011-12 season. In the short go finals on Saturday night, Winchell stepped up to the challenge and posted the fastest time in the rodeo with a 6.1 second run. Winchell has graduated from EWC and will attend Chadron State College in the fall.

EWC RODEO CNFR QUALIFIERS
01 May 2012FOUR EWC RODEO TEAM MEMBERS QUALIFY FOR NATIONALS
Four Eastern Wlyoming College Rodeo athletes qualified for the 2012 College National Finals Rodeo (CNFR). Representing the Lancers are: Sheby Winchell, goat tying; Derek Weinreis, team roping; Levi O'Keeffe, team roping; and Riley Pruitt, tie down roping. The CNFR will be in Casper, Wyoming on June 10-16, 2012.
Sophomore Shelby Winchell of Scottsbluff, Nebraska, moved from fourth in the standings to second with her performance at the University of Wyoming rodeo last weekend. Winchell won the Reserve Champion Goat Tying award for the Central Rocky Mountain Region.
Freshmen Derek Weinreis of Beach, ND and Levi O"Keeffe of Mohall, ND won the Reserve Champion Award in their event; Weinreis as the header and O'Keeffe as the heeler.
Sophomore Riley Pruitt from Gering, Nebraska will making his second trip to the CNFR in tie down roping. Pruitt finished in third place in the regional standings to earn the right to rope in Casper in June. Last year as a freshman, Pruitt finished fourth in the nation and has had an outstanding career at EWC.

EWC RODEO STANDINGS
16 April 2012Several EWC cowgirls and cowboys are in the top ten in the Central Rocky Mountain Region of College Rodeo with two rodeos left on the spring schedule. These athletics are attempting to accumulate enough points to qualify for the College National Finals in Casper in June. Jordan McAllister is third in the bull riding standings, Lane Hall sits in seventh place in the saddle bronc event, and Troy Wilcox is fifth in tie down roping, seventh in team roping as a header, and fifth in the men's all-around. Second place in team roping is held down by Derek Weinreis and Levi O'Keefe, with header Trae Seebaum in ninth place, and heelers Tee Hale and Trae Kautzman in sixth and eighth place. The EWC Women's team has Shelby Winchell in fourth place in goat tying. The EWC teams will be in Casper on April 20-22 and finish the season in Laramie on the last weekend in April.
